Many replies here dismissing sleep deprivation because you think you can just "get by".
You can just "get by" with smoking too. With a shortened lifespan.
https://www.medicalnewstoday.com/articles/307334.php
> Although occasional sleep interruptions are generally no more than a nuisance, ongoing lack of sleep can lead to excessive daytime sleepiness, emotional difficulties, poor job performance, obesity and a lowered perception of quality of life.
> Sleep loss alters normal functioning of attention and disrupts the ability to focus on environmental sensory input
> Lack of sleep has been implicated as playing a significant role in tragic accidents involving airplanes, ships, trains, automobiles and nuclear power plants
> Children and young adults are most vulnerable to the negative effects of sleep deprivation
> Sleep deprivation can be a symptom of an undiagnosed sleep disorder or other medical problem
> When you fail to get your required amount of sufficient sleep, you start to accumulate a sleep debt.
> Sleep deprivation can negatively affect a range of systems in the body.
It can have the following impact:
> Not getting enough sleep prevents the body from strengthening the immune system and producing more cytokines to fight infection. This can mean a person can take longer to recover from illness as well as having an increased risk of chronic illness.
> Sleep deprivation can also result in an increased risk of new and advanced respiratory diseases.
> A lack of sleep can affect body weight. Two hormones in the body, leptin and ghrelin, control feelings of hunger and satiety, or fullness. The levels of these hormones are affected by sleep. Sleep deprivation also causes the release of insulin, which leads to increased fat storage and a higher risk of type 2 diabetes.
> Sleep helps the heart vessels to heal and rebuild as well as affecting processes that maintain blood pressure and sugar levels as well as inflammation control. Not sleeping enough increases the risk of cardiovascular disease.
> Insufficient sleep can affect hormone production, including growth hormones and testosterone in men.

Also, PSA about a lesser known sleep disorder:
https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Delayed_sleep_phase_disorder
> Delayed sleep phase disorder (DSPD), more often known as delayed sleep phase syndrome and also as delayed sleep–wake phase disorder, is a chronic dysregulation of a person's circadian rhythm (biological clock), compared to those of the general population and societal norms. The disorder affects the timing of sleep, peak period of alertness, the core body temperature rhythm, and hormonal and other daily cycles. People with DSPD generally fall asleep some hours after midnight and have difficulty waking up in the morning.[1] People with DSPD probably have a circadian period significantly longer than 24 hours.[2] Depending on the severity, the symptoms can be managed to a greater or lesser degree, but no cure is known, and research suggests a genetic origin for the disorder.
